Cabling should be Category 3 or better. Between any two end-stations in a collision domain, there may be up to five cable segments and four intermediate repeaters hubs, hub stacks, or other repeaters. If there is a path between any two end-stations containing five segments and four repeaters, then at least two of the cable segments must be point-to-point link segments e. Another approach to pushing beyond the limits of Ethernet technology is the development of switching technology.
A switch bridges. Switching is a cost-effective way of increasing the total network capacity available to users on a local area network. By doing this the total network capacity is multiplied, while still maintaining the same network cabling and adapter cards. Switching LAN technology is a marked improvement over the previous generation of network bridges, which were characterized by higher latencies.
Routers have also been used to segment local area networks, but the cost of a router, the setup and maintenance required make routers relatively impractical.
Today switches are an ideal solution to most kinds of local area network congestion problems.
